热门关键词:
                            当前位置:主页 > 区块链 >

                            如何使用以太坊钱包连接私有网络?

                            时间:2025-03-26 04:46:55 来源:未知 点击:

                            随着区块链技术的不断发展,以太坊作为一种流行的智能合约平台,吸引了众多开发者和企业的关注。以太坊不仅支持公共网络,还允许用户创建和维护私有网络。私有网络通常用于企业内部应用,提供更加安全和隐私的环境。本篇文章将详细介绍如何使用以太坊钱包连接私有网络,并解答相关问题。

                            什么是以太坊私有网络?

                            以太坊私有网络是一个相对封闭的网络,只允许被选择的参与者接入。与公共以太坊网络不同,私有网络有以下几个显著特征:

                            • 隐私: 由于控制节点的访问权限,数据隐私得以增强,适合需要保护敏感信息的企业应用。
                            • 控制权: 私有网络允许企业对区块链进行更多的控制,包括共识机制、节点管理和资源分配。
                            • 可扩展性: 私有网络通常具有更好的性能和可扩展性,因其不受公共网络流量影响。

                            如何创建以太坊私有网络?

                            要创建一个以太坊私有网络,用户需要完成以下步骤:

                            1. 安装以太坊客户端: 下载并安装以太坊客户端,如Geth(Go-Ethereum)或Parity。Geth是最常用的以太坊客户端,可以帮助您创建并管理私有网络。
                            2. 配置创世区块: 创世区块是私有网络的起点,用户需要准备一个创世文件,定义区块的初始条件,包括账户余额、区块时间等。
                            3. 启动节点: 使用命令行启动以太坊节点,确保它在您的机器上运行并监听特定的端口。
                            4. 使用网络标识: 在节点启动时,必须指定网络ID,以确保节点加入正确的私有网络。

                            实际上,私有网络的创建过程可以通过不同的方式实现,以上是最基本的步骤,具体操作可能因网络需求而有所不同。

                            如何使用以太坊钱包连接私有网络?

                            一旦成功创建私有网络,用户接下来需要将以太坊钱包连接到此网络,以便进行交易和管理资产。以下是连接的步骤:

                            1. 下载并安装以太坊钱包: 选择一种以太坊钱包,例如MetaMask或Mist,并根据其官方文档进行安装。
                            2. 配置钱包: 打开钱包应用程序,并选择设置选项。用户需要配置网络设置,包括RPC URL、链ID和网络名称,以使钱包识别您的私有网络。
                            3. 导入账户: 如果用户已经在私有网络上创建账户,则需要导入私钥或助记词到钱包,以便获取操作权限。
                            4. 执行交易: 完成以上设置后,用户就可以在钱包中查看账户余额并执行交易。

                            常见问题解答

                            如何确保私有网络的安全性?

                            确保私有网络的安全性是一项重要的任务,特别是在企业环境中。以下是一些最佳实践:

                            • 访问控制: 确保只有被授权的用户可以访问网络。可以使用IP白名单或VPN连接来限制访问。
                            • 节点安全: 确保运行节点的服务器具备合理的安全配置,及时更新操作系统和软件,避免安全漏洞。
                            • 智能合约审计: 如果在私有网络上运行智能合约,务必进行代码审计,确保没有隐藏的安全漏洞。

                            私有网络和公共网络的主要区别是什么?

                            私有网络与公共网络在多方面存在显著区别,包括:

                            • 访问权限: 公共网络是开放的,任何人都可以成为节点并参与网络。私有网络则是封闭的,只有特定用户可以参与。
                            • 性能: 由于参与者数量有限,私有网络通常具有更高的交易速度和更低的延迟。
                            • 共识机制: 公共网络通常使用工作量证明机制(PoW),而私有网络可以选择更符合其需求的共识机制。

                            如何从私有网络迁移到公共网络?

                            如果需要将资产从私有网络迁移到公共网络,可以遵循以下步骤:

                            1. 资产评估: 评估私有网络上所有资产的状况和价值,以确保在迁移过程中的透明度和准确性。
                            2. 创建智能合约: 在公共网络上创建一个智能合约,以接受来自私有网络资产的迁移请求。
                            3. 配置桥接机制: 可以使用桥接技术来处理资产从私有网络到公共网络的转移,确保数据和资金的安全。
                            4. 执行迁移: 在确认所有条件满足后,执行资产迁移操作,确保资产被正确转移至公共网络钱包。

                            综上所述,连接以太坊私有网络的过程并不复杂,只需遵循正确的步骤即可实现。了解私有网络的特点及其与公共网络的主要区别,有助于您在选择使用时做出更为合理的决策。希望上述信息能够帮助您更好地利用以太坊钱包及其私有网络进行操作。